Notice about data
recorded by the Event
Data Recorder and
vehicle control modules
Event Data Recorder
This vehicle is equipped wi th an Event Data Re
corde r (E DR). The main purpose of an EDR is to
reco rd, in ce rtain c rash o r ne ar cras h-like sit ua
tions, such as an a irbag deployment or hitting a
road obstacle , data that will assis t in understand
ing how a vehicle's systems performed. The EDR
is designed to record data re lated to veh icle dy
namics and safety systems for a short period of
time, typically 30 seconds or less. The EDR in this
vehicle is designed to record such data as:
- How vario us systems in you r vehicle were oper
at ing;
- Whether or not the driver and passenger safety
gi belts were buckled/fastened; ......
~ - How fa r (if at all) the driver was depressing the
N ~ acce le rato r and/o r bra ke peda l; and,
0 LL 00
Intellig ent Technology
- How fast the vehicle was traveling.
T hese data can help p rovide a bette r understand
i ng of the circumst ances in w hich cras hes and in
ju ries occu r. NOTE: EDR data ar e recorded by your
vehicle on ly if a non -trivial crash s ituation occurs;
no data are reco rded by the ED R under norma l
driv ing cond itions and no persona l data (e .g .,
name, gender, age, and crash location) are re
corded. However, other parties, such as law en
forcement, could comb ine the EDR data with the
type of personally identify ing data rout inely ac
quired d uring a c rash investigation .
To read data recorded by an EDR, special equ ip
ment is required, and access to the vehicle or the
E DR is needed . In addition to the ve hicle manu
factu rer, other part ies, such as law e nfo rcement,
t h at have the special equipment, can rea d the in
f o rmat io n if they have a ccess to the vehicle or the
ED R.
Some sta te laws restrict the retrieval o r down
l oad ing of data sto red by ED Rs ins talled in a veh i
cl e for the exp ress p urpose of re triev ing da ta af
ter an acci dent or crash event without the own
er 's consent .
Audi will not a ccess the EDR and/or sim ila r data
o r g ive it to o thers -
- unless the veh icle owne r (or lessee if the vehi
cle has been leased) ag rees; o r
- upon the official request by the police; or
- upon the order of a court of law or a govern-
ment agency; or
- for the defense of a lawsuit through the jud ic ia l
discovery process.
-Aud i may a lso use the data fo r research abo ut
veh icle operation and safety perfo rmance or
prov ide the data to a third party for research
purposes witho ut ide ntify ing the specific veh i
cle or i nfo rmat ion about the ident ity of its own
er or lessee and only afte r th e re co rded veh icle
d ata has been a ccessed.

Energy management
Starting ability is optimized
Energy management controls the distribution of
electrical energy and thus optimizes the availa
bility of electrical energy for s tarting the engine.
If a veh icle wit h a conventional energy system is
not driven for a long per iod of t ime, the battery is
d ischa rged by idling current consumers (e.g. im
mo bilizer). In cert ain cir cums tan ces it c an result
i n there be ing insuff ic ient ene rgy available to
start the engine.
I ntell igen t energy management in your veh icle
h andles the distr ib ution of ele ct ric al ene rgy.
S tarting ab ility is mar ked ly imp roved an d the l ife
of the batte ry is extended.
B asically, e nergy management consis ts of
bat
tery diagno sis, idling curr ent management
and
dynamic energy management .
Intelligent Technology
Battery diagnosis
Battery diagnos is con tinuously dete rmi nes the
state o f the bat tery . Sensors determine battery
vo ltage, battery c urrent and batte ry tempera
tu re. This determines t he current state of charge
and the power of the battery.
Idling current management
Id ling cur rent management reduces ene rgy con
s u mption whi le the vehicle is standing . With the
ignition switched off, it contro ls the energy sup
ply to the vario us electrical components . Data
from battery d iagnosis is cons idered.
Depend ing on the ba ttery's s tate of charge, indi
vidual consumers are gradually turned off to pre
vent excess ive discharge of t he battery and thus
mainta in starting capab ility.
Dynamic energy management
While t he vehi cle is being d riven, dynami c energy
management dis trib utes the energy generate d
according to the needs of the individual compo
nents. It regulates consumption, so that more
electrical e nergy is not being used than is being
generated and ensures an opt imal state of
charge for the battery .

Driving and the
environment
Breaking in
New engine
The engine needs to be run-in during the first
1,000 miles (1,500 km).
For the first 600 miles (1 ,000 kilometer s):
"' Do not use full throttle .
"' Do not drive at engine speeds that are more
than
2/3 of the max imum permitted RPM .
From 600 to 1,000 miles (1 ,000 to 1 ,500
kilometers):
"' Speeds can gradually be increased to the maxi
mum pe rm issib le road or engine speed .
During and after break-in pe riod
"' Do not rev the engine up to high speeds when it
is cold. This applies whether the transmission is
in N (Neutral) or in gear .
After the break-in period
"'Do not exceed maximum engine speed under
any c ircumstances.
"'U pshift into the next higher gear
before reach
ing the red area at the end of the tachometer
sca le
c=>page 8.
During the first few hours of driving, the eng ine's
internal friction is higher than later when all the
mov ing parts have been broken in . How well this
b reak-in process is done depends to a considera
b le exte nt on the way the veh icle is d rive n during
t he first 1,000 miles (1,500 kilometers).

Catalytic converter
It is very important that your emission control
system (catalytic converter) is functioning prop erly to ensure that your vehicle is running in an
environmentally sound manner .
~ Always use lead-free gasoline ¢ page 188,
Fuel supply .
~ Never run the tank down a ll the way to empty .
~ Never put too much motor oil in your engine
¢ page 19 7, 9::?l Adding engine oil .
~ Never try to push- or tow-start you r vehicle.
The cata lytic converter is an efficient "clean-up"
dev ice bu ilt into the exha ust system of the vehi
cle. The cata lytic conve rter burns many of the
pollutants in the exhaust gas before they are re
leased into the atmosphere.
The exclusive use of unleaded fue l is critica lly im
portant for the l ife of the catalytic conve rter and
p roper functioning of the engine.

Trailer towing Driving with a trailer
General information
Your Audi was designed primarily for passenger
transportation .
If you plan to tow a trailer, please remember that
the additional load will affect durability, econo
my and performance.
Trailer towing not only places more stress on the
vehicle, it also calls for more concentration from
the driver.
For this reason, always follow the operating and
driving instructions provided and use common
sense.
Technical requirements
Trailer hitch
Use a weight-carrying hitch conforming to the
gross trailer weight. The hitch must be suitable
for your vehicle and trailer and must be mounted
securely on the vehicle's chassis at a technically
sound
location . Use only a trailer hitch with a re
movable ball mount . Always check with the trail
er hitch manufacturer to make sure that you are
using the correct hitch.
Do not use a bumper hitch.
The hitch must be installed in such a way that it
does not interfere with the impact -absorbing
bumper system . No modifications should be
made to the vehicle exhaust and brake systems .
From time to time, check that all hitch mounting
bo lts remain securely fastened.
